NXP Semiconductors N.V.

Senior Engineer, HW-SW Co-Design

Pune Full time

This role is a senior engineer that bridges between HW and SW to ensure world-class solutions for our customers. This role resides and works alongside the HW team to reuse and develop low level drivers and application to be a bridge to central SW team. Responsible for ensuring high quality HW drivers to take full advantage of HW features and make them available via the SDK to customers (internal and external). This role will drive HW-SW to ensure consistency, early verification of drivers, combined use-cases and ROM features in simulation and in emulation before silicon tape out. The role will also ensure that product verification (SW + HW teams) and all validation teams are enabled with the same drivers for validation of the product.

Job Responsibility:  

  • Developing low‑level IP firmware (device drivers) for MCU platforms, ensuring high quality and reusability. Work closely with central SW teams to maximize reuse, consistency and ensure HW compatibility.
  • Deliver comprehensive IP firmware/driver solutions that support all phases of the lifecycle—RTL verification, virtual simulation, SoC verification, post‑silicon validation, and SDK integration
  • Partner with pre‑silicon and post‑silicon teams to align HAL/SDK development with IP interface requirements and features.
  • Work closely with HW, SW architects and SOC designers to initiate firmware development in parallel with hardware development.
  • Review hardware register definitions and documentation early and regularly to remove disconnects and provide actionable feedback to improve software usability and long‑term maintainability. This role owns any gap closure.
  • Establish and maintain backward‑compatible software interfaces as hardware IP evolves across products. Ensure linkage with HW IP and central SW team.
  • Support multiple execution environments—simulation, emulation, and silicon—to ensure robust API behavior.
  • Champion quality practices including design reviews, code reviews, static analysis, and adherence to coding standards.
  • Produce clear, comprehensive technical documentation, reports, and presentations for stakeholders and milestone reviews.
  • Use Git, JIRA, and Confluence to drive project execution, collaboration, and traceability.
  • Contribute to ongoing optimization of firmware development workflows, tools, and cross‑team processes.

 Job Qualification: 

  • Bachelor’s or Master’s degree in Electrical Engineering, Electronics Engineering, or a related field.
  • Experience in RTL simulation and emulation. Must be able to understand how SOC’s are built and be able to work with RTL, HW and SW verification environments.
  • Minimum of 8 years of experience in architecture and/or firmware development for MCUs/MPUs.
  • Deep expertise in MCU/MPU SW architecture and low‑level firmware development, including RTL bring‑up, driver design, and platform‑level integration.
  • Experience leveraging AI capabilities to accelerate software development and documentation.
  • Proficiency with ARM processor subsystems, tools, and debugging methodologies.
  • Experience working with embedded RTOS and compilers.
  • Competence in low‑level software testing and debugging for MCUs and MPUs.
  • Ability to work in a multi‑site, multi‑time‑zone environment.
  • Proficiency in C/C++/Assembly languages and at least one scripting language.
  • Excellent problem‑solving, analytical, and debugging skills.
  • Strong communication and interpersonal skills, with the ability to effectively collaborate with cross‑functional teams and mentor junior engineers.
  • Prior experience in a technical leadership role, driving projects and influencing technical direction is highly desirable.
